aix7.1命令有哪些常用操作?

AIX 7.1作为IBM Power Systems上广泛使用的UNIX操作系统,其命令行工具提供了强大的系统管理和维护能力,掌握常用命令对于系统管理员来说至关重要,以下将详细介绍AIX 7.1中的核心命令及其应用场景,帮助用户高效完成系统管理任务。

Aix7.1命令
(图片来源网络,侵删)

系统信息与状态查询

在系统管理中,首先需要了解系统的当前状态。uname -a命令可以显示系统的所有基本信息,包括操作系统名称、节点名称、版本号、硬件型号等,执行后会输出类似”AIX mynode 7 1 00F724154C00″的结果,7″表示AIX 7.1版本。lscfg命令用于查看硬件配置,通过lscfg -v -p可以列出所有设备的详细属性,包括型号、序列号和固件版本,这对于硬件故障排查至关重要。topas命令是实时系统监控工具,可以动态显示CPU、内存、磁盘I/O和网络的使用情况,管理员可以通过它快速定位资源瓶颈。

用户与权限管理

AIX采用基于角色的访问控制(RBAC),用户管理命令包括useraddusermoduserdel,创建用户时,useradd -m -d /home/username -s /usr/bin/ksh username会同时创建家目录并指定默认Shell。passwd username用于设置用户密码,而chage -M 90 username可设置密码过期时间为90天,权限管理方面,chmod修改文件权限,chown更改文件所有者,chgrp更改文件所属组,特殊权限位包括SetUID(4)、SetGID(2)和Sticky Bit(1),例如chmod 4755 /usr/bin/sudo会给程序所有者执行权限,且以所有者身份运行。

存储与文件系统管理

AIX的存储管理主要通过Logical Volume Manager(LVM)实现。lsvg命令显示卷组信息,lsvg -o列出所有卷组;lslv -l lvname查看逻辑卷的详细信息,创建文件系统时,先使用mklv -y lvname -t jfs2 vgname 10G创建逻辑卷,再执行crfs -v jfs2 -d lvname -m /mountpoint -A yes创建JFS2文件系统。mount命令挂载文件系统,umount卸载,df -g显示文件系统空间使用情况,对于存储管理,lsdev -Cc disk列出所有磁盘设备,extendvg vgname hdiskX可向卷组添加新磁盘。

进程与性能管理

ps -ef列出所有进程,top实时显示进程状态,终止进程使用kill -9 PID强制结束,killall -9 processname按名称终止进程,性能监控方面,vmstat 5每5秒显示一次内存和CPU统计信息,iostat 2监控磁盘I/O性能,netstat -i查看网络接口统计。sar -u 1 10每秒收集一次CPU使用情况,共10次,帮助分析CPU负载。

Aix7.1命令
(图片来源网络,侵删)

网络配置与管理

网络配置主要通过ifconfig命令,例如ifconfig en0 up激活网卡,ifconfig en0 192.168.1.100 netmask 255.255.255.0设置IP地址。netstat -rn显示路由表,route add -net 192.168.2.0 -netmask 255.255.255.0 en0添加静态路由,网络服务管理使用srcmstr命令,lssrc -g tcpip查看TCP/IP子系统状态,startsrc -s tcpip启动服务。

软件包管理

AIX使用bff(Backup File Format)和installp命令管理软件包。lslpp -l列出已安装的软件包,installp -acgXw fileset安装软件包,uninstallp fileset卸载软件包,对于维护级别更新,oslevel -r显示当前维护级别,emgr -l -v查看错误日志,fixdist应用修复包。

备份与恢复

系统备份是关键任务,backup -i -f /dev/rmt0 /home将/home目录备份到磁带,restore -xvf /dev/rmt0恢复文件。mksysb创建系统备份镜像,mksysb -i /dev/lv00将镜像保存到逻辑卷,网络备份可通过tar -cvzf backup.tar.gz /home打包后传输到远程服务器

常用命令速查表

命令类别命令示例功能描述
系统信息uname -a显示系统详细信息
硬件配置lscfg -v -p列出硬件设备属性
用户管理useradd -m username创建用户并创建家目录
权限管理chmod 755 file修改文件权限为rwxr-xr-x
逻辑卷管理mklv -y lv vg 10G创建10GB逻辑卷
文件系统管理crfs -v jfs2 -d lv创建JFS2文件系统
进程管理ps -ef列出所有进程
网络配置ifconfig en0 up激活网卡
软件包管理lslpp -l列出已安装软件包
系统备份mksysb创建系统备份镜像

相关问答FAQs

Q1: 如何在AIX 7.1中查找包含特定文本的文件?
A: 使用grep命令结合find,例如find /path -type f -exec grep "text" {} +会在/path目录下递归查找包含”text”的文件,也可使用grep -r "text" /path实现相同功能。

Aix7.1命令
(图片来源网络,侵删)

Q2: AIX 7.1中如何检查磁盘错误?
A: 使用errpt -a查看系统错误日志,重点关注DISK类型的错误,也可通过lscfg -v -p hdiskX检查磁盘详细信息,或使用diagnose命令运行硬件诊断程序。

文章来源网络,作者:运维,如若转载,请注明出处:https://shuyeidc.com/wp/372645.html<

(0)
运维的头像运维
上一篇2025-09-29 15:19
下一篇 2025-09-29 15:24

相关推荐

  • dos命令大全 下载

    在Windows操作系统中,DOS命令(即命令提示符或CMD命令)是用户与系统交互的重要方式,通过输入特定指令可以快速完成文件管理、系统配置、网络诊断等任务,以下是常用DOS命令的详细分类及使用说明,部分命令支持通过“下载”相关资源(如驱动程序、工具脚本)来增强功能,具体操作会结合命令特性展开,文件与目录管理命……

    2025-11-20
    0
  • Macbook Air终端命令有哪些实用技巧?

    MacBook Air 终端命令是 macOS 系统中强大的工具,允许用户通过文本界面直接与系统交互,执行文件管理、系统配置、网络诊断等多种任务,对于开发者、系统管理员或希望提升效率的普通用户而言,掌握终端命令能够显著简化操作流程,解锁系统隐藏功能,以下将详细介绍 MacBook Air 终端命令的基础使用、常……

    2025-11-20
    0
  • 苹果系统命令大全有哪些实用指令?

    苹果系统(macOS)基于Unix内核,拥有强大的命令行工具(Terminal),通过命令可以高效管理文件、系统设置、网络等,以下是常用命令的分类详解,涵盖文件操作、系统管理、网络工具、开发者工具等多个场景,帮助用户全面掌握macOS命令行使用技巧,文件与目录操作文件管理是命令行的基础,常用命令包括ls(列出目……

    2025-11-20
    0
  • 纯DOS模式命令有哪些基础操作?

    纯DOS模式命令是早期计算机操作系统中常用的指令集,主要通过命令行界面与系统交互,DOS(Disk Operating System)是磁盘操作系统的缩写,其核心特点是单任务、字符界面,用户需输入特定命令完成操作,以下将详细介绍常用DOS命令的功能、语法及示例,帮助理解其基础应用,文件和目录管理是DOS操作的基……

    2025-11-20
    0
  • Dos命令大全.chm有哪些常用命令?

    dos命令大全.chm 是一份详细记录 Windows 操作系统命令行工具的电子书文档,它系统性地整理了 DOS(Disk Operating System)及 Windows 命令提示符(CMD)下的常用命令、参数说明及实例应用,是学习、查阅和掌握命令行操作的重要参考资料,本文将围绕该文档的核心内容,分类介绍……

    2025-11-19
    0

发表回复

您的邮箱地址不会被公开。必填项已用 * 标注